One end of a light spring of spring constant k is fixed to a wall and the other end is tied to a block placed on a smooth horizontal surface. In a displacement, the work done by the spring is kx 2 . The possible cases are

A
the spring was initially compressed by a distance x and was finally in its natural length
B
it was initially stretched by a distance x and finally was in its natural length
C
it was initially in its natural length and finally in a compressed position
D
it was initially in its natural length and finally in a stretched position

The correct answer is:
CHECK THE SOLUTION.

(a, b)

W S = U i – U f , kx 2 = U i – U f

U f = 0

U i = kx 2 = k(–x) 2

Spring was either compressed or stretched initially by a distance x.
